¿Cómo convertirse en un gurú de la tecnología?
Pregunta 1: Cómo convertirse en un maestro de programación Hola, en realidad todavía soy un estudiante de último año. No puedo decir que pueda brindarte ninguna experiencia, solo algunas sugerencias.
Comencé a aprender Java cuando era estudiante de segundo año y luego trabajé en algunos proyectos JavaEE para mi profesor. Cabe decir que los algoritmos no se usaban mucho en nuestros proyectos, y principalmente involucraban algunas operaciones de bases de datos. Mi hobby es tener un conocimiento profundo de los algoritmos. Las estructuras de datos son muy importantes para los programadores.
De hecho, lo principal de la programación es poder soportar la soledad y no querer aprender todo lo que ves, al menos al principio no hace falta que sea demasiado amplio. Bajaré y aprenderé uno o temas relacionados en profundidad. Estudiaré algunos temas durante un período de tiempo y luego buscaré amplitud técnica después de alcanzar cierta altura.
He hablado de más cosas en HI.
Pregunta 2: Cómo convertirse en un "maestro" técnico 1) La confianza primero. La confianza es algo muy extraño. La gente puede tener una confianza inexplicable al principio, pero todo comienza a partir de ahí. Si crees que eres bueno en eso, definitivamente lo serás. Por el contrario, si sientes que no eres bueno en eso, definitivamente no lo serás. La confianza es el primer paso para que podamos girar el volante. Con este paso, el volante de nuestra capacidad girará cada vez más rápido.
2) No seas impaciente. Debe haber mucha solidez detrás de las grandes personas. Estas personas suelen dedicar mucho tiempo a estudiar y pensar para poder mejorar. La sociedad actual es una sociedad impetuosa. Para llegar a ser una gran persona, debes resistir la tentación. Las cosas que son fáciles de escuchar de los demás a menudo significan que las cosas a las que se refieren son fáciles de depreciar, y las habilidades que poseen las grandes personas generalmente no son fáciles de depreciar, porque se obtienen a cambio de un largo período de soledad y muchos La gente no puede soportar este tipo de La agonía de la soledad.
3) Un lenguaje de programación es solo un lenguaje de programación, pero debes dominarlo; de lo contrario, no podrás escribir la palabra competente en tu currículum (su currículum dice competente en C/C++, pero en realidad No lo domina. Cuando le pregunté, dijo que se sentía muy culpable cuando escribió estas dos palabras). Dominar el lenguaje de programación utilizado es como un pintor que aprende a utilizar un bolígrafo. Es una habilidad básica para convertirse en un experto. Lo que realmente encarna a Niu es nuestro pensamiento de diseño, que es un espíritu persistente en la búsqueda de la belleza del diseño. Las ideas de diseño se obtienen mediante el pensamiento y la acumulación a largo plazo. Además de leer más libros, echar un vistazo al código fuente de Open Source puede mejorar enormemente su fortaleza interna. Además, a medida que las personas envejecen, ayuda a formar sus propias ideas de diseño, lo que también lleva tiempo.
4) Debemos tener un espíritu persistente para afrontar las dificultades. Este espíritu es también una forma eficaz de construir nuestra confianza en nosotros mismos. Las personas excelentes a menudo se convierten en personas sobresalientes porque han resistido la prueba de enfermedades difíciles y complicadas. Se convierten en personas sobresalientes porque pueden manejar cosas que otros no pueden.
En general, creo que el estudiante que hizo esta pregunta es bastante reflexivo, por lo que acepto contratarlo. En cuanto a su experiencia, no le doy mucha importancia. Un estudiante que está a punto de ingresar a su segundo año de posgrado no puede contar con su gran capacidad técnica. Otra cosa que sostengo es que la tecnología es fácil de aprender.
Pregunta 3: ¿Hasta qué punto necesitas ser técnicamente fuerte para convertirte en un experto técnico con un salario anual de un millón? ¿Esto depende de en qué especialidad estés? Cada industria tiene estándares diferentes. En primer lugar, trabaje en usted mismo primero y no se preocupe demasiado por el salario; de lo contrario, definitivamente no llegará a ese punto al final.
Pregunta 4: ¿Está bien cambiar? a TI? ¿Convertirse en un experto en tecnología? Debido al trabajo, muchos amigos le preguntan a Xiaozhuo sobre las opciones profesionales en la vida diaria. No están satisfechos con su situación profesional y planean aprender a programar y convertirse en programadores.
Bueno, tengo una idea. Internet ha sido popular durante muchos años y todavía se está calentando. Si realmente eres apto para la tecnología, es muy inteligente elegir TI.
Habiendo cambiado de carrera como programador a mitad de camino, ¿cuál es la situación actual del mercado laboral?
Dejando de lado otros factores, hablemos simplemente del salario: punto de referencia de la industria
El salario de BAT es el siguiente
Baidu
Alibaba
Tencent
¿Lo sabes? Para la mayoría de las personas que deciden convertirse en programadores a mitad de camino, siempre que ingresen al círculo de TI y acumulen algunos proyectos, se puede lograr un salario como el anterior.
Si tienes habilidades sobresalientes y no eres de una especialidad, Xiao Zhuo sugiere que puedes destacar a través de proyectos personales influyentes y una brillante página personal
Github, o puedes usar el programa para Si la red social donde se reúnen los miembros está activa y es reconocida por otros grandes nombres, naturalmente estarán dispuestos a ayudarlo a recomendarla.
El Sr. Wang Jiangmin, quien escribió sobre el antivirus de Jiangmin, sufrió secuelas de polio cuando tenía tres años y quedó discapacitado en las piernas. Después de graduarse de la escuela secundaria, regresó a su ciudad natal y. Comenzó a trabajar como aprendiz en una fábrica callejera y finalmente se convirtió en un experto en mecánica y optoelectrónica con más de
más de 20 inventos. A la edad de 38 años, Jiang Min comenzó a aprender informática. Unos años más tarde, se convirtió en el primer experto en antivirus de China y fundó el influyente Jiangmin Anti-Virus.
El Sr. Wang Jiangmin es el tipo de persona que aprende cualquier cosa rápidamente y tiene perseverancia. Estas personas pueden tener éxito en cualquier cosa que hagan.
“La vida es infinita, la lucha es infinita”, este no es sólo un dicho heroico, también nos dice que querer ser un maestro técnico no se logra de la noche a la mañana. Tener los pies en la tierra, aprender desde cero y perseverar es el arma mágica para ganar.
No hay un punto de parada en la vida, la realidad es siempre un nuevo punto de partida. No importa cuándo y dónde, siempre que elija la industria de TI y pueda dedicarse a aprender, Xiaozhuo cree que se convertirá en un verdadero maestro técnico en un futuro cercano.
Pregunta 5: ¿Hasta qué punto es necesario ser técnicamente fuerte para convertirse en un gigante técnico con un salario anual de un millón? La industria del automóvil se basa exclusivamente en la tecnología y es imposible no alcanzar puestos directivos.
Por supuesto, mi conocimiento es limitado. La empresa conjunta ha sido independiente durante más de seis años. Si la has visto, por favor dame algún consejo.
Pregunta 6: ¿Cómo puedes convertirte en un experto en TI con un salario anual de un millón? 1. Capacidad de pensamiento inverso al resolver problemas
Ante nuevos problemas encontrados en el trabajo, ¿te encuentras? De repente confundido. No se encontró ninguna solución. Además, es posible que el jefe no tenga ningún truco bajo la manga. Son buenos utilizando el pensamiento inverso para explorar formas de resolver problemas. Saben que es más fácil para los ejecutivos de empresas específicas identificar los nodos problemáticos que para sus jefes, ya sea un problema técnico o un vacío de gestión; Usar el pensamiento inverso para encontrar soluciones a los problemas hará que sea más fácil deshacerse de ellos.
2. La capacidad de pensar desde la perspectiva de otras personas al considerar problemas.
Al considerar soluciones a los problemas, la gente común suele abordarlos lo más rápido posible desde la perspectiva de sus propias responsabilidades. , pero siempre consideran conscientemente soluciones a los problemas desde la perspectiva de la empresa o del jefe. Como empresa o jefe, lo primero que hay que considerar al resolver problemas es cómo evitar que se repitan problemas similares, en lugar de tratar de resolver el problema tratándolo. Siempre pueden posicionarse desde la perspectiva de la empresa o del jefe y proponer soluciones a los problemas, y poco a poco se convierten en personas dignas de confianza.
3. Mejor capacidad de resumen que otros.
Su capacidad para analizar, resumir y resumir problemas es mejor que la de la gente común. Siempre puedes encontrar cosas regulares y controlarlas para lograr el doble de resultado con la mitad del esfuerzo. La gente suele decir que trabajar duro es peor que trabajar con habilidad. Pero no todos saben cómo hacerlo con habilidad, de lo contrario no harían lo mismo. La gente común está ocupada todo el día y no tiene tiempo para hacerlo, pero es muy inteligente todo el día.
4. Capacidad para redactar documentos concisos.
Los jefes normalmente no tienen tiempo para leer documentos extensos. Por lo tanto, es particularmente importante aprender a redactar informes escritos concisos y preparar tablas agradables. Incluso si el problema es complejo, pueden condensarlo en una página de papel A4. Las cuestiones que requieran una explicación detallada deben adjuntarse al informe o formulario como archivos adjuntos. Deje que su jefe obtenga una descripción general de todo con solo escanear una página o tabla. Si estás interesado en este asunto o crees que es importante, puedes conocer más leyendo la información en el archivo adjunto.
5. Capacidad de recopilación de información
Se preocupan por recopilar todo tipo de información, incluidas diversas políticas, informes, planes, programas, informes estadísticos, procesos comerciales, sistemas de gestión y evaluaciones. etc. Preste especial atención a la información de la competencia. Porque cualquier proceso empresarial exitoso en sí mismo es la acumulación de muchas experiencias y lecciones, que pueden aprenderse fácilmente cuando sea necesario. Esto no se puede encontrar en ningún libro de texto ni puede enseñarlo ese maestro.
6. Capacidad para formular soluciones a problemas
Cuando encuentren problemas, no pedirán a los líderes que respondan "preguntas" sino "preguntas de opción múltiple". Cuando la gente corriente encuentra problemas, primero informa a sus líderes y pide instrucciones sobre cómo resolverlos. Utilice sus oídos para escuchar las instrucciones del líder sobre pasos específicos. A esto se le llama pedir a los líderes que hagan "preguntas y respuestas". Y a menudo aportan múltiples soluciones a los problemas que han elaborado para que los líderes elijan y decidan. Esto es lo que los líderes suelen llamar "preguntas de opción múltiple". Obviamente, los líderes prefieren hacer "preguntas de opción múltiple".
7. Capacidad de ajuste de objetivos
Cuando los objetivos personales no se pueden lograr en una organización y no pueden escapar de este entorno por el momento, a menudo ajustarán los objetivos a corto plazo y cambiarán. los objetivos Los objetivos se combinan orgánicamente con los objetivos de desarrollo de la empresa. De esta forma será más fácil que todos se acerquen o coincidan en sus opiniones, tendrán el mismo lenguaje y serán felices. A su vez, otros estarán felices de aceptarlos.
8. Súper capacidad de autoconfort.
A menudo pueden autoconsolarse y aliviarse cuando se encuentran con fracasos, reveses y golpes. También resumirá rápidamente experiencias y lecciones y creerá firmemente que la situación cambiará. Su creencia es: una bendición disfrazada, o Dios te abrirá una ventana cuando te cierre una puerta.
9. Habilidades de comunicación escrita
Cuando descubren que la comunicación cara a cara con el jefe no es efectiva, utilizarán otros métodos, como correos electrónicos, o cartas escritas o informes. Intente comunicarse. Porque la comunicación escrita a veces puede lograr efectos que la comunicación lingüística cara a cara no puede lograr. Puede explicar de manera más completa las opiniones, sugerencias y métodos que desea expresar. Logra el objetivo de dejar que el jefe escuche lo que tienes que decir, en lugar de interrumpir tu discurso o que tus pensamientos interrumpan el teléfono en su escritorio. También es conveniente que tu jefe elija un momento en el que crea que es libre de "escuchar" tus "regaños".
10. Adaptabilidad a la cultura corporativa
Tendrán una fuerte adaptabilidad a la cultura corporativa de la nueva organización. Cambiar a una nueva empresa es como cambiar la ubicación de una oficina. Aún puedes trabajar felizmente y ser reutilizado como pez en el agua.
11. La capacidad de resistir los cambios de trabajo
A medida que la competencia se intensifica y los riesgos comerciales aumentan, el éxito o el fracaso de una empresa puede ocurrir de la noche a la mañana. Para ellos, no hay nada que temer ante un cambio de empleo o incluso la pérdida de su empleo. ......>>
Pregunta 7: ¿Cómo deberían los fundadores que no entienden de tecnología encontrar un buen gurú de TI? Deben encontrar un amigo confiable, porque la tecnología de TI implica mucho, y lo son. detrás de escena, lo que puede hacer está más allá de su imaginación. Si el servidor de cuentas de fondos del proyecto, etc., puede hacerlo (devuelve datos falsos y los propios desarrolladores conocerán los datos reales), no lo recomiendo. si no encuentras un nuevo amigo, haz algo como esto
Pregunta 8: Cómo convertirte en un maestro en tecnología informática Hola, yo todavía soy un estudiante de último año, no puedo. Digo que puedo darte cualquier experiencia, sólo algunas sugerencias.
Comencé a aprender Java cuando era estudiante de segundo año y luego trabajé en algunos proyectos JavaEE para mi profesor. Cabe decir que los algoritmos no se usaban mucho en nuestros proyectos, y principalmente involucraban algunas operaciones de bases de datos. Mi hobby es tener un conocimiento profundo de los algoritmos. Las estructuras de datos son muy importantes para los programadores.
De hecho, lo principal de la programación es poder soportar la soledad y no querer aprender todo lo que ves, al menos al principio no hace falta que sea demasiado amplio. Bajaré y aprenderé uno o temas relacionados en profundidad. Estudiaré algunos temas durante un período de tiempo y luego buscaré amplitud técnica después de alcanzar cierta altura.
He hablado de más cosas en HI.
Pregunta 9: ¿Cómo convertirse en un maestro? Me tomo la libertad de brindar algunas sugerencias, que básicamente se traducen:
1. Ignora a los detractores 2. Comienza con [x] amp 3. Aprenda los conceptos básicos 4 Aprenda en línea a través de tutoriales como code academy y lynda
5 Lea algunos libros: php cookbook, php para principiantes absolutos, etc.
6 Escriba un código simple : tablero de mensajes, foros, blogs, etc.
7 Escribe algo complejo: ORM, una biblioteca de clases que implementa un requisito específico, etc.
8 Ponte en contacto con un framework liviano : CI, kohana, etc.
9 Aprenda un framework completo: ZF, Symfony, etc.
10 Cree algunas aplicaciones interesantes
11 Haga buen uso de flujo de trabajo: git, etc.
12 Sigue aprendiendo
13 Ten la mente abierta, aprende las ventajas de Ruby, etc.
Creo que esto no es gran cosa , porque PHP y front-end (javascript), estrechamente relacionados con el servidor (linux), y el conocimiento de las extensiones C para complementar el conocimiento de la web, también es necesario aprender y comparar las ventajas de otros lenguajes. (python, ruby, go, etc.) y la red (, tcp/ ip, etc.)
¿Es esto suficiente? Tal vez.